Mastering Advanced Data Visualization: Techniques and Best Practices
In today's data-driven world, the ability to effectively visualize information has become a critical skill for professionals across various fields. Advanced data visualization not only helps in conveying complex information clearly but also enhances decision-making processes. This article will delve into advanced concepts of data visualization, exploring various elements that contribute to creating impactful reports and dashboards.
One of the fundamental aspects of effective data visualization is the design of reports. Well-designed reports typically start with a comprehensive summary on the first page, providing an overview that captures the audience's attention. This initial snapshot is crucial, as it sets the tone for the detailed analysis that follows. By employing clear and concise visual elements, such as graphs and charts, the viewer can quickly grasp the key messages without feeling overwhelmed by an excess of information.
As we transition into the intricacies of report design, it is essential to consider the limitations and capabilities of various tools. For instance, applications like Power BI offer robust features for data analysis but have constraints regarding the design of reports on mobile platforms. These applications focus more on the consumer experience rather than the design elements, which can pose challenges for professionals aiming to deliver visually appealing reports. Understanding these limitations can help users tailor their approach, ensuring that the final product meets both aesthetic and functional requirements.
Another critical aspect of advanced data visualization involves the use of objects and elements within reports. Reports should be viewed as a cohesive unit of security and publication, where all components are interconnected. Each page within a report carries equal importance, and the information presented must be consistent in terms of size, layout, and background. This uniformity not only enhances the visual appeal but also aids in maintaining the credibility and professionalism of the report.
Moreover, the selection of visual elements plays a pivotal role in data representation. The use of appropriate charts, graphs, and tables can significantly affect how the information is perceived. For example, line charts are excellent for displaying trends over time, while bar charts can effectively compare different categories. The key is to choose the right type of visualization that aligns with the data being presented and the message that needs to be conveyed.
Incorporating interactivity into visualizations can further elevate the user experience. Interactive dashboards allow users to explore data dynamically, offering them the ability to drill down into specific areas of interest. This engagement not only keeps the audience invested but also fosters a deeper understanding of the underlying data. Tools like Power BI facilitate this interactivity, enabling creators to design experiences that resonate with users.
To effectively harness the power of advanced data visualization, consider the following actionable advice:
-
Start with a Clear Objective: Before diving into the design process, define the primary goal of your report. Understand your audience's needs and expectations to tailor your visualizations accordingly.
-
Emphasize Consistency: Ensure that your report maintains a consistent design in terms of colors, fonts, and layout. This uniformity not only enhances aesthetics but also aids in comprehension, allowing viewers to focus on the data rather than the design elements.
-
Utilize Feedback: After creating your visualizations, seek feedback from colleagues or potential users. This input can provide valuable insights into how effectively your report communicates its intended message and highlight any areas for improvement.
In conclusion, mastering advanced data visualization is a multifaceted endeavor that combines design principles with an understanding of data analysis. By focusing on clear objectives, ensuring consistency, and embracing user feedback, professionals can create compelling reports that not only inform but also engage their audience.
